Understanding the Physics of the Plinko Board
The seemingly random nature of the plinko board’s outcome is, in fact, governed by principles of physics, although predicting the exact path of the disc is incredibly difficult. The initial placement of the disc is critical, but even a perfectly centered drop doesn’t guarantee a specific result. Each peg acts as a point of deflection, and the angle at which the disc strikes each peg dictates its subsequent trajectory. This creates a complex system of cascading probabilities, where tiny variations in the initial conditions can lead to vastly different endings. The distribution of pegs is also a significant factor; their density and arrangement influence the overall flow of the disc and the likelihood of it landing in particular slots. Understanding these basic principles doesn't allow for control, but it does illuminate why the game feels both chaotic and logically consistent.
The Role of Friction and Peg Material
Beyond the basic angles of deflection, several subtler factors contribute to the unpredictability of the plinko board. Friction between the disc and the pegs plays a role, subtly altering the disc’s speed and trajectory with each impact. The material composition of both the disc and the pegs also matters; a smoother disc will experience less friction, while the elasticity of the pegs impacts the rebound angle. Even environmental factors, such as slight vibrations or air currents, can introduce minuscule variations that compound over the course of the descent. These are often overlooked, yet these small details collectively contribute to the game’s inherent randomness. Considering these nuances reveals why creating a truly predictable plinko board is a substantial engineering challenge.

The Evolution of the Plinko Game
The origins of the plinko concept can be traced back to a game show staple – a staple of televised game shows for decades. The original format, popularized in the 1980s, involved a large, physical board and contestants dropping chips in hopes of winning cash prizes. This created a dramatic and visually engaging spectacle for viewers. However, the game has undergone a significant transformation in recent years, largely due to the rise of online casinos and cryptocurrency platforms. The digital adaptation has allowed for increased accessibility, greater customization, and the introduction of innovative features.
Digital Adaptations and Cryptocurrency Integration
Online plinko games often feature adjustable risk levels, allowing players to tailor the game to their preferences. Some versions offer bonus features, such as multipliers or special peg arrangements, adding an extra layer of complexity. The integration of cryptocurrency has also been a game-changer, providing a secure and transparent platform for wagering and payouts. The provably fair systems utilized by many crypto plinko games ensure that the outcome of each round is verifiable and unbiased. This has fostered greater trust and confidence among players. The ease of access and the potential for larger rewards have made digital plinko games incredibly popular within the crypto gaming community.

The Psychological Appeal of Randomness
The enduring popularity of the plinko game isn't solely attributable to its simple mechanics or potential for financial gain. It also taps into a deeper psychological phenomenon: our fascination with randomness. Humans are inherently pattern-seeking creatures, but we are also drawn to the unpredictable. The plinko board provides a compelling blend of both – a system governed by physical laws, yet capable of producing seemingly random outcomes. This creates a sense of suspense and excitement, as we eagerly await the final destination of the disc. The anticipation of the drop, the visual spectacle of the descent, and the hope of a favorable outcome all contribute to a captivating experience.
Moreover, the game’s simplicity allows players to quickly grasp the rules and focus solely on the experience. There’s no complex strategy to master, no hidden algorithms to decipher – just pure, unadulterated chance. This can be incredibly liberating, offering a momentary escape from the pressures of everyday life. The feeling of relinquishing control and trusting to fate can be surprisingly enjoyable. The plinko game, in essence, provides a controlled environment for exploring the unpredictable, allowing us to experience the thrill of risk without significant consequences.
